On a screen with a device pixel ratio of 2.0, the following widget would render the images/2x/cat.png file:. Image.asset('images/cat.png') This corresponds to the file that is in the project's images/2x/ directory with the name cat.png (the paths are relative to the pubspec.yaml file).. On a device with a 4.0 device pixel ratio, the images/3.5x/cat.png asset would be used Flutter - Asset Image. Flutter is an open-source, cross-platform UI development kit developed by Google. It is gaining popularity these days, as the app made in flutter can run on various devices regardless of their platform. It is majorly used to develop applications for Android and iOS, as a single app made in flutter can work efficiently. Fetching assets. When fetching an image provided by the app itself, use the assetName argument to name the asset to choose. For instance, consider the structure above. First, the pubspec.yaml of the project should specify its assets in the flutter section: flutter: assets: - icons/heart.png Then, to fetch the image, use: AssetImage('icons/heart. Assets, images, and icon widgets. Manage assets, display images, and show icons. See more widgets in the widget catalog. Asset bundles contain resources, such as images and strings, that can be used by an application. Access to these resources is asynchronous so that they... A Material Design icon How to Insert Image from Asset Folder in Flutter App. In this example, we are going to show you the basic practice to add or insert images from the asset folder in Flutter App. Images are very important for any web and app development for interactive design. See the example below to insert images in your app from asset folder
Here in this tutorial, we use Image.asset to display an image from the assets bundle. Simple Implementation Step 1. The first step is to create a new folder and name it assets at the root of the Flutter project directory as shown in the image. Now add the image inside the newly created assets directory. Step 2. The image added inside the. This Flutter tutorial gives examples of how to display an image stored in asset folder and adjust the image width, height, color, etc. The images that will be displayed must be stored in particular folders You're using your asset path, the path relative to the root of your Flutter project. However, this path doesn't exist in the device's documents folder, so the file can't be created there. The file also doesn't exist in the assets folder because you're prepending the documents path
Flutter Asset Image. Assets Image widget uses an image from the root directory of your project, before using any image you have to add image path to pubspec.yaml file. I have created an images. Thank you for being with us on this Flutter Journey!!! we hope you got what you were looking for!! So in this article, we have been through how to convert asset images to file in flutter. Stay Connected for more amazing articles regarding Flutter Development and Dart!! Keep Learning!!! Keep Fluttering!!
First of all, create a folder named images inside your Flutter project directory. Now, add an image inside images folder. After that, open pubspec.yaml file from your project folder and find the line showing. # To add assets to your application, add an assets section, like this: # assets: # - images/a_dot_burr.jpeg Hey ninjas, in this Flutter tutorial I'll show you how to work with images. I'll show you two types of Image widget - the network image widget and the asset. Flutter [web] image assets do not work. #33659. kenthinson opened this issue May 31, 2019 · 30 comments Comments. Copy link kenthinson commented May 31, 2019. When I load a image asset the result is nothing displays. If I load from network it works fine. Flutter for mobile works fine with the same code
You will how to display flutter image using CircleAvatar Widget with background color. Network Image and Json loaded images could be shown using circle avata.. Access 7000+ courses for 60 days FREE: https://pluralsight.pxf.io/c/1291657/424552/7490 Beginners flutter tutorial where you'll see how to use Image ( bitmap..
Solution 3. You should start image path with assets word: image: AssetImage ('assets/image1.png') you must add each sub folder in a new line in pubspec.yaml. then dont forgot to run flutter clean. So it's all About All possible solutions Flutter has an Image widget that allows displaying different types of images in the mobile application. How to display the image in Flutter. To display an image in Flutter, do the following steps: Step 1: First, we need to create a new folder inside the root of the Flutter project and named it assets. We can also give it any other name if you want Generate Flutter Image Asset. July 19, 2020 Images. Spider. A small dart library to generate Assets dart code from assets folder. It generates dart class with static const variables in it which can be used to reference the assets safely anywhere in the flutter app. Example Befor Commonly, you will need to display images in assets to the application. I will show you how to do load image from assets in Flutter the easy way. Load image from assets in Flutter. In general, to load image from assets, you will need to follow these steps: Create an assets directory and put in static images. Define assets to be used in pubspec.yam
Flutter apps can include both code and assets (sometimes called resources). An asset is a file that is bundled and deployed with your app, and is accessible at runtime. Common types of assets include static data (for example, JSON files), configuration files, icons, and images (JPEG, WebP, GIF, animated WebP/GIF, PNG, BMP, and WBMP). Introductio fit image landscape flutter. auto adjust image flutter. flutter fill an image in a container. flutter container box fit image. ClipRRect + image.fil fill fully + flutter. ClipRRect + image.fil fill fully. image fit only with in container in flutter. fit image flutter container. flutter how to size image in given space how to use image asset in in container decoration; tow image inside one container flutter; how to add image from assets inside as a decoration image in container; i cone with image in flutter; container image in decoration flutter; image within container flutter; flutter image out of container; how to insert an image in a boxdecoraton in flutter
Assets can be an image, files, fonts etc. Adding an image. To add an image asset, Right-click on the Project folder and select New-> Directory and name it images. Now add an image to the folder ( Just copy and paste simple). Using image assets. To use an asset in Flutter, it should be specified in pubspec.yaml. So, to add image assets to our. Output: Set Image Transparency/Opacity. For setting the transparency or opacity of the background image, you can pass the colorFilter argument. In the example below, we create a ColorFilter with an opacity of 0.2. The blending mode is set to dstATop, which composite the destination image (the transparent filter) over the source image (the background image) where they overlap . In simple words an asset is a file that is bundled and deployed with your app. multi_image_picker: ^4.8.0 http: ^0.13.1 provider: ^5.0.0 modal_progress_hud: ^0.1.3 path_provider: ^2.0.1 flutter_absolute_path: ^1.0.6 Inorder to use path_provider p acakage please set the minimum SDK to 19 in your app build.gradle fil
var image = new Image (image: assetsImage, width: 48.0, height: 48.0); return new Container ( child : image ) ; We've created assets directory in our Flutter app to store all our images used in this project and defined that in pubspec.yaml fil Flutter random Image.asset changes on hovering Button? Ask Question Asked 3 days ago. Active yesterday. Viewed 19 times 0 I want to show a random picture everytime the user enters the page. I also have a Button (the red container with hovering) on this page, and when the user is hovering it, a new random picture shows, but it shouldn't change. Displaying the original image/video. The asset data can be retrieved as a File using the file getter of the AssetEntity objects. For images. We can simply display the original image using Image.file(), let's create the ImageScreen widget: NOTE: make sure to import File from dart:io and not dart:htm
To use a local image, you have to add it to your project. We'll download the above square image to a folder named images: Then declare it in the flutter section of the pubspec.yaml file: flutter: assets: - images/square.jpeg. Now everything is ready, let's jump into the code 加载 images. Flutter可以为当前设备加载适合其分辨率的图像。 声明分辨率相关的图片 assets. AssetImage 了解如何将逻辑请求asset映射到最接近当前设备像素比例的asset。 为了使这种映射起作用，应该根据特定的目录结构来保存asset The solution is quite simple. We need to pre-load the image before it is rendered. If it is preloaded and cached, the rendering of image when needed may seem instantaneous. Okay let's see how can we implement Precaching in Flutter. Here in this tutorial, we will learn the correct way to pre-cache a network image
Copy required images to the folder like following. Add definition of image files. In pubspec.yaml, we need to declare a list of images which will be used in the app. flutter: uses-material-design: true assets: - assets/nature1.jpg - assets/nature2.jpg Show image with Image.asset. Image.asset contructor creates a widget that displays an. Flutter actually has an image library built in to the core library which you can use. For loading local, static images you can use the following tutorial. Adding assets and images See the example below to blur asset or network images in Flutter app. First, add blur Flutter package in your dependency by adding the following lines in pubspec.yaml file. dependencies: flutter: sdk: flutter blur: ^3.0. In this tutorial, we have loaded image over network. You can also, load an image from assets. Example. In this example, we will create a Flutter Application to display an image as a circular disc in UI. To recreate this application, create a basic Flutter Application and replace main.dart with the following code. main.dar Flutter Photo View widget with zoomable image gallery. Step 1: Create new Flutter project. Step 2: Add Dependencies. Step 3: import the photo view widget package. Step 4: Create a folder (assets) and add path to asset folder in pubspec.yaml file. Zoom image flutter basic code base. Photo View Gallery
flutter_svg #. Draw SVG (and some Android VectorDrawable (XML)) files on a Flutter Widget.. Getting Started #. This is a Dart-native rendering library. Issues/PRs will be raised in Flutter and flutter/engine as necessary for features that are not good candidates for Dart implementations (especially if they're impossible to implement without engine support) Four constructors for adding image from Network Url, Asset Image, Image from file and from memory. Controls from constructors like strokeWidth and Colors. Export image as memory bytes which can be converted to image. Implementation provided on example; Ability to undo and clear drawings. [Note] Tested and working only on flutter stable channel Image widget is an essential widget in Flutter because without image you cannot develop a beautiful app. Images express the content better than text. 1. Flutter Network Image. Network Image widget uses the internet to show the image, you can use any URL of an image to display the image. It is better to use Network Image over Asset Image because.
Flutter Unable to load asset image. FlutterError: Unable to load asset, You should consider the indentation for assets flutter: assets: - images/pizza1. png - images/pizza0.png. More details: flutter: [2 whitespaces or 1 This clears the image cache, meaning that Flutter will then attempt to load the images fresh rather than search the cache Flutter Image - Rounded Corners To display an image with rounded corners or circular shaped corners, place the Image widget as child of ClipRRect widget with circular border radius specified for the ClipRRect widget. Let us learn briefly what this ClipRRect is. ClipRRect is a Flutter widget that clips its child with a rounded rectangle. You can specify a specific border radius for this. Rotate an image an arbitrary number of degrees: Transform.rotate; Flip an image on it's X or Y axis: Matrix4.rotationX, Matrix4.rotationY; Animate the flipping or rotation of an image Rotate and flip an image in Flutter, with or without animations. This article will show you how to flip an image in Flutter on it's horizontal or vertical axis Opacity Widget in Flutter. Last Updated : 02 Sep, 2020. The Opacity widget that makes its child partially transparent. This class colors its child into an intermediate buffer and then merges the child back into the scene partially transparent. For values of opacity other than 0.0 and 1.0, this class is relatively expensive as it needs coloring.
Example. This is an example Flutter application where we display an image with padding applied to it. To recreate this example, create a basic Flutter application and replace main.dart with the following code. When you run this Flutter Application, you may observe an image displayed with padding around it, as shown in the below screenshot 12.9k11831. Image is a StatefulWidget and Image.asset is just a named constructor, you can use it directly on your widget tree. AssetImage is an ImageProvider which is responsible for obtaining the image of the specified path. If you check the source code of the Image.asset you will find that it's using AssetImage to get the image So now that we've incorporated that image into our project, it's time to tell Flutter that the image exists. And to do that, we're going to go into the configuration file, which is our pubspec.yaml file. And if you scroll down, you'll see that it even tells you in a comment, that this is how you add assets to your application [FlutterGen] generates Image class if the asset is Flutter supported image format. Example results of assets/images/chip.jpg: Assets.images.chip is an implementation of AssetImage class. Assets.images.chip.image.
. Actual results: Images appear with short delay <details> <summary>Logs</summary> logs_flutter_doctor.txt logs_flutter_analyze.txt logs_verboose.txt </details> slow image lod As you can see the background image and the logo image both have a delay, I also tried to precache the image How to Set Network Image In Circular Avatar In Flutter ? Example 1 CircleAvatar With Network Image. To use CircleAvatar we need to define our Network OR Asset Image in backgroundImage property. also, give radius that will our image radius. For example like below. [ Image source unsplash.com ] How to get the image in the pdf is sometimes getting hard to achieve. So i summarize the code in an easy way. There are two ways to show a pdf via share the pdf with other apps and open into a prin
We need to import the image files into the project. It is common practice to put image files in a images or assets folder at the root of a Flutter project.. Declare the Image in the pubspec.yaml. pubspec.yaml. flutter: uses-material-design: true assets: - images/flutterwithlogo.png main.dart Fil FlutterGen generates Image class if the asset is Flutter supported image format. Example results of assets/images/chip.jpg: Assets.images.chip is an implementation of AssetImage class. Assets.images.chip.image(...) returns Image class. Assets.images.chip.path just returns the path string In any case we want to tell Flutter that the first column (the image) can stay the way it is with its width and height of 56 pixels whereas the text has to be told to only use the available space. This can be achieved with a widget called Expanded. We also need to remove the Spacer as it's not needed anymore when the text takes up as much. ===== Exception caught by image resource service ===== The following assertion was thrown resolving an image codec: Unable to load asset: assets/images/rose.jp Image Asset - In Flutter, developers use images from the assets folder. In development mode, this will be useful as the images are loaded faster. But when you bundle the app these images add more weight to the app. The solution is to use network images. Upload the images in a permanent storage path like AWS and use the link to that image in.
The semantic label describes the purpose of the image. This value does not show in the UI. These values used in screen readers to identify the purpose of the image. It best practice to apply this value of the widget needs more accessibility. Also, flutter has semantics widget with more controls of the properties how to convert image url to asset in flutter? Ask Question Asked 3 days ago. Active 3 days ago. Viewed 25 times 0 i used multi_image_picker package to get images from gallery.now i want to implement edit page and i need to convert my images url list to asset and set the asset list to multi_image_picker. here is my multi image picker:. Introduction to Flutter- The What's and The Why's Play. Introduction To Dart. Reason why Dart holds the fort strong. Play. Installing Visual Studio Code and the Dart Plugin. Importing images as assets. Some images need to be bundled along with the app and this is how you do it
First of all, add asset for your mobile app logo in the pubspec.yaml like this;. flutter: # The following line ensures that the Material Icons font is # included with your application, so that you can use the icons in # the material Icons class. uses-material-design: true assets: - assets/ Don't forget to give 2 space before '-' and 1 space after '-' for image location specification Contents in this project Add Assets Images Folder Path in Pubspec.yaml File iOS Android Tutorial: 1. Create a folder named as assets in your Flutter project like i did in below screenshot. 2. Inside the assets folder create another folder named as images. In the images folder we will put our all local images. 3 You need to follow this article to add images to your project, How to add an image to the Project? - FlutterCentral and then, copy the below code into your main.dart file. Note: Make sure you have updated the image file names as appropriate. In this example, you can observe that I have used ListView to display multiple Images The problem was that the size of my images were too big, something around 2000x1500, I downsized them to 1000x750, and now it's working fine. level 1. mgtechnologies. 1 point · 2 years ago. I think you should try this script. It will automatically preload images with jQuery. <script>. var images = [
Step 5: Specify the image file names or file directory (images) as assets. Adding entire folder. Here we can access all files inside the 'images' folder. Or specify the filenames separate: Don't forget to specify file format such as jpg, png, jpeg, gif, etc. Now you can import these images on your flutter application using these codes . Flutter Gallery The images come with predefined colors. Sometimes, we may need to tweak the color. In this Flutter tutorial, let's discuss how to change the color of an image. To change the color of an image, I prefer ColorFiltered widget of Flutter. It accepts colorFilter property which changes the color filter of the child Assets, images, and icon widgets. To add assets to a Flutter application, you need to create an assets folder in the root directory. Update the pubspec.yaml file to serve all assets in the assets folder globally throughout the application. Assets such as fonts, images, and icons can be added to the folder for easy access from any part of the application..
Add a flutter_svg dependency also can specify the latest version to avoid code level issues. dependencies: flutter_svg: Also specify the assets folder so that all the images and other resource files can be specified in this files.And then directly specify the folder in pubspec instead of individual files. assets: - assets/ New Flutter developers need to understand state management in order to build more complex applications with multiple screens and data storage options. Image. asset ('assets/images.
Images in Flutter PDF. 5 May 2021 2 minutes to read. Images are supported through the PdfImage class, which is an abstract base class that provides functionality for PdfBitmap class.. Inserting an image in PDF document. The following raster images are supported in Flutter PDF Flutter doesn't provide any widget to Create Circle Image. In this post, we are going to create a circler image in a flutter application. This example will show just a basic screen with a circle image and loading the image from URL, as well as from Asset . Let's get started. Step 1: Create a Flutter application. Step 2: Create a file circler. Android Studio includes a tool called Image Asset Studio that helps you generate your own app icons from material icons, custom images, and text strings.It generates a set of icons at the appropriate resolution for each pixel density that your app supports. Image Asset Studio places the newly generated icons in density-specific folders under the res/ directory in your project It seems that if I start a flutter project in debug mode and stop it for a while, there seem to be a lot of dart.exe (in case I used web) or java.exe (in case I used Android) processes even after I closed the IDE (VS Code or AS). These take gigabytes of RAM
Before doing some coding, let's see how images are loaded in Flutter and what the splash effect means. Images in flutter. In flutter apps, we can load images from network, assets (App resources) or from the file system. Loading images from network is very easy task in flutter using Image.network constructor The AssetManifest.json represents a list of all assets in the application. We load it into the json string - manifestContentJson, using the async-await mechanism and then we make a map - manifestMap out of it using the json.decode command. Subsequently, we select only those assets from the map, which are present in the 'assets/images/' folder. Then we return a list of paths to those. Flutter uses asset variants when choosing resolution-appropriate images. In the future, this mechanism might be extended to include variants for different locales or regions, reading directions, and so on F rom Title, it's pretty clear that you are going to learn about uploading Image to the Server in Flutter application.. Most of the people know that how we can upload the image to the Firebase Server, that's quite easy we just pass the File and that's it.Firebase has strong Plugin which does everything for us but What if we don't use the Firebase